Transaction 660d4eb8b4671e812c4ccecfb771851df99d2824a918e3aa60ab28e764030071
2 Input
2 Outputs
- 660d4eb8b4671e812c4ccecfb771851df99d2824a918e3aa60ab28e764030071:0
- 660d4eb8b4671e812c4ccecfb771851df99d2824a918e3aa60ab28e764030071:1
value 750000
address 17FWrEUVXwvPip6obqBgSZQyqesnPS2YeE
value 31240000
address 1CU33AxiDVmmPhKckyEKwdCii3CLRRz4To